Understanding Periodic Table Fonts

Periodic table fonts are specialized typefaces designed to represent chemical elements, their symbols, and related information in a visually coherent manner. These fonts are particularly useful in educational materials, scientific publications, and digital platforms where accurate representation of chemical data is essential.​

Common applications include:​

  • Educational resources and textbooks
  • Scientific presentations and posters
  • Digital tools for chemistry learning​

Keyboard Shortcuts and Chemical Notation

Standard keyboard shortcuts facilitate the input of basic chemical expressions. For instance, in certain educational platforms, users can input subscripts and superscripts using specific keyboard commands . However, these shortcuts are limited in scope and do not provide a comprehensive solution for typing all periodic table elements directly.​

Limitations include:​

  • Inability to input element symbols with a single keystroke
  • Lack of support for displaying atomic numbers or weights
  • Dependence on external tools or manual formatting​

Custom Solutions for Periodic Table Fonts

To address these challenges, several specialized fonts have been developed. These fonts allow users to represent chemical elements more effectively. For example, certain fonts designed for chemical notation enable the display of element symbols, atomic numbers, and other relevant data in a structured format.​

Additionally, software tools and plugins have been created to support chemical notation:​

  • Chemical equation editors integrated into word processors
  • Plugins for typesetting systems like LaTeX
  • Online platforms offering interactive periodic tables​

Innovative Approaches and Community Projects

Beyond specialized fonts and software, the community has explored innovative approaches to facilitate chemical input. One notable example is the concept of a custom keyboard layout inspired by the periodic table. In a community discussion, a user proposed designing a keyboard where each key corresponds to an element, allowing for direct input of element symbols .​

Such projects, while primarily conceptual, highlight the demand for more intuitive methods of typing chemical information. They also underscore the potential for integrating educational tools with hardware solutions to enhance learning experiences.​
